During a recent company IT audit, it was found that a blonde was using the following password:

“MickeyMinniePlutoHueyLouieDeweyDonaldGoofyPhoenix ”

When asked why she had such a long password, she said she was told that it had to be at least 8 characters and include at least one capital.

At my office due to PCI compliance, we have to change our passwords once every 90 days and it has to be a complex password.

PCI compliance is required as we store credit card information on our servers.

I'm the administrator of the systems here and everyone bitches each time as the password cannot be repeated for 5 cycles.

Oh the joys of being an administrator.
